This morning we completed the cut-over of the translation-string extraction script to the new Stringharvest pipeline. Extraction now runs nightly instead of on-demand, and missing-key reports land in the shared tracker automatically. If customers report untranslated text, please check the latest extraction run before escalating — most gaps resolve within one cycle. Known limitation: strings inside legacy template partials still need manual tagging. For troubleshooting, the extraction service runs with the configuration below.

service settings:
PRAWYN_PIN=9848
PRAWYN_METRICS_HOST=metrics.prawyn.lumicworks.corp
PRAWYN_LOG_LEVEL=warn
PRAWYN_TENANT=pelius

Notes — loan pieces call, Tues

Quick recap for the folks at Harrowfield Gallery receiving the crates: the three pieces from the Velmering Collection arrive Friday, padded crates, condition reports tucked inside each lid. Please don't open anything until our registrar, Piet, is on site — insurance thing, apparently non-negotiable. Keep the crates in the climate room, not the loading corridor. The courier will expect the following hand-over instruction to be carried out exactly.

dispatch memo: the eliath belael courier leaves the praox ledger at gate 8841 under passcode 017589

- [ ] Verify Paystrand integration suite is green before tagging. Known flaky tests: refund replay, dual-currency settlement, webhook timeout. If any of these fail once, rerun the suite; do not escalate unless they fail twice in a row. Support should not file customer-facing incidents for these failures — they are test-harness timing issues, not production defects. Confirm quarantine list matches the release notes. Log any new flaky test names in the tracker. Attach the run's trace token, which appears below.

pipeline stamp: htk3_69f

**Ticket #9071: i18n extraction blocked, vault locked**

On-call: the `stringreap` extraction script failed at 02:10. It pulls translator credentials from the Fennel vault; vault auto-locked after a node reboot. Extraction queue is backing up, release cut is at noon. Don't rerun the script until the vault is open or it'll mark all strings stale. Restart steps are in the ops doc. Unseal the vault first using the passphrase below.

vault phrase of bawep-tafop = wendor-silael-julwyn-pelox-kasion-oliox-ralax